| A guest gave the hostel 4 out of 5 and said: I spent most of the time outside the hostel sightseeing London and western England. I stayed in a six-person, all-female room. I didn't spend any time in the bar so I can't really comment there. The subway is not that far a walk from the hostel. The hostel is one block away from a park and a major shopping mall and cafes. Location is safe. Pros: The beds were comfortable. Staff were OK. Nice and clean hostel all-round. There is a sink and mirror in the rooms. Individual lockers in the room (just bring your own lock). Internet is cheap. Cons: There was no where to hang your towel or clothes in the shower. The chips and burger I ordered were dry. Using the payphones were confusing. Sometimes there was no hot water. |
